About our school
Southern Cross Catholic College is a Prep to Year 12 school offering families a co-educational pathway to life-long learning. The College was founded in 1995 following the amalgamation of the Catholic primary and secondary schools in the Moreton Bay Region.
The multi-campus College operates as the principal Catholic College on the Redcliffe peninsula. Southern Cross Catholic College has three campuses located in Scarborough, Kippa Ring and Woody Point accommodating students in Prep to Year 6 and a fourth campus in Scarborough accommodating middle and senior years students from Year 7 to 12.
